Mr. Eddie Lee Riggins, 61 of Alexander City, Alabama peacefully transitioned home on Monday, January 13, 2020 at his Residence.
Funeral service for Mr. Eddie Riggins of Alexander City, Alabama (formerly of Phenix City, Alabama) will be held 12:00 Noon Thursday, January 23, 2020 at Taylor's Funeral Home Chapel with interment following at Edmond Cemetery in Phenix City, Alabama.
Visitation will be held at Wright's Funeral Home in Alexander City on Tuesday, January 21, 2020 from 2:00 until 6:00 p.m.
Mr. Eddie Lee Riggins graced this life with his presence on April 30, 1958, to the late Robert and Sallie Mae Riggins in Pittsview, Alabama. He quietly departed this life on January 13, 2020, at his home in Alexander City.
Eddie confessed Christ as his Savior at an early age. Eddie worked at Fort Benning, in later years he worked for the Tallapoosa County Housing Authority until his death.
He enjoyed spending time with his family and friends. He loved to dance and enjoyed life. Eddie was preceded in death by his parents and four siblings, Sallie Bell Riggins, Alicia Mae Dixon, Johnnie L. Riggins, and Robert Riggins, Jr.
Eddie’s memory will forever be cherished in the lives of: five devoted and loving children, Savalas (Keischa) Williams of Atlanta, GA, Cowana Riggins, Theophilus Davis of Columbus, GA, Eric Riggins of Ft. Lauderdale, FL, Shenedra Stewart of Ft. Lauderdale, FL; ten loving grandchildren, Kadara Riggins, Kenttrall Riggins, Joseph Forbes, Kendall Williams, Tanaza V. Davis, Theophilus Davis, Jr., Sha-Nyria Davis, TyKera Johnson, Jaquez Riggins, and Triston Riggins; two loving siblings, Annie Riggins and Barbara Smith both of Phenix City, AL; a sister-in-law, Vickie Parker Riggins; one aunt, Nellie Jackson; one uncle, Jimmy Mack; two devoted friends, Jackie Wyckoff and Anthony Scott; and a host of nieces, nephews, cousins, other relatives, and friends.
